Exploring the Cultural Critique and Potential Benefits of Universal Basic Income
This chapter explores the impacts of universal basic income on work ethic and familial obligations, discussing the weakening of traditional care relations in a globalized market economy and potential replacements. It highlights the shifting views of conservatives and argues that basic income can provide income security while maintaining incentives for personal growth and community responsibility.
